GP03 AMU is a 2003 Fiat Multipla in Grey with a 1,910c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 11 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 72.7%.
Across all 2003 Fiat Multipla models, the average MOT pass rate is 64.0% with a typical mileage of 76,840 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Fiat Multipla f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 19,746 recorded failures. If you're considering buying GP03 AMU,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Fiat Multipla typically stays on UK roads for around 27 years. At 23 years old, this Fiat Multipla is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
